Vegetarian Fat Loss - 7 Tips to Lose Fat for Overweight Vegetarians

Weight gain doesn't happen overnight. You must have adopted wrong eating habits in your vegetarian lifestyle that make you become overweight. Now you need to lose fat, not just losing weight, as a vegetarian. Take these 7 tips with you wherever you go and you'll shed fat without breaking a sweat!

When we mess up our lifestyle by taking the wrong diet and adopting the wrong habits, weight gain occurs, regardless of whether you're a vegetarian or not. No doubt losing fat as a vegetarian seems relatively easier, still you must adhere to the correct way in order to achieve effective weight loss. Here I share with you 7 vegetarian fat loss tips that I've used on myself and get results. You too, will slim down soon after you apply them. Get ready for a shape-up!

Vegetarian Fat Loss Tip 1 - Keep Your Stomach Un-empty

One of the effective tips to lose fat is to avoid starving your stomach. When starved, your stomach will act like a ferocious "vacuum cleaner". It'll suck it in any food that comes in with all its might. As a consequence, you absorb more calories than you need when you keep it hungry for some time.

So, don't ever let your stomach go hungry. The moment it rumbles especially between main meals, give it some food (but healthy ones). And it will keep your metabolism boosted for consistent fat-burning.

Vegetarian Fat Loss Tip 2 - Eat More to Lose Fat

Break your larger vegetarian meals into 3 smaller meals + 2 snacks. This will keep you metabolically active throughout the day without starving your stomach. So long as your stomach doesn't go empty, and when you need more energy for more physical activities, your body will turn to your fat storage for energy source. You burn fat. But bear in mind, no high-sugar, high-salt, high-fat "junky" vegetarian food.

Vegetarian Fat Loss Tip 3 - Increase Your Vegetable Intake

Vegetables provide good fiber and abundance of phytonutrients to satisfy your bodily needs. Moreover, fibrous food makes you feel full easily so you're less likely to overeat comparing to those who eat less veggies. Additionally, it takes more energy to break down the complex structure within the vegetable than the caloric value itself, resulting in a calorie deficit (more fat loss).

Vegetarian Fat Loss Tip 4 - Stop Eating When 70% Full

Eating too full can easily trigger metabolic disorder, which leads to weight gain instead of weight loss. So, keep your stomach at 70% satiation for the main meals and 30 - 40% for snacks.

Vegetarian Fat Loss Tip 5 - Eat Slowly

In relation to Tip 4, your stomach requires about 10 - 20 minutes (rarely as fast as 2 minutes) to register satiety with your brain so your brain can signal a "stop" to your urge for food. As such, eating slowly allows you to work closely with your stomach. This is very effective in controlling weight gain and you'll naturally lose weight over time even with just this tip alone.

Vegetarian Fat Loss Tip 6 - Avoid Drinking Too Much Water

Don't blindly follow the myth about drinking 8 glasses or 2 liters a day. Some people get water poisoning by drinking that amount. No one knows better than yourself on how much you need daily. Check the color of your urine. Clear or pale yellow means you're having enough fluid in your body for proper hydration and optimal fat-burning response. Increase your water consumption when it turns yellow.

Vegetarian Fat Loss Tip 7 - Get Quality Sleep

When we don't sleep well, our body will enter a metabolic disorder; either your metabolism runs abnormally high or the other way round. But in most cases, you'll experience sluggish metabolism upon poor sleep quality. So, if you want to get more fat burned at an efficient rateFree Web Content, get quality sleep by turning in before 11PM at night.
